TUSCALOOSA, Ala. (AP) Freshman Tony Mitchell scored 23 points to lead four Alabama players in double figures as the Crimson Tide gave first-year coach Anthony Grant his first victory, 86-69 over Jackson State on Tuesday night.
Ahead 40-35 at halftime, Alabama (1-1) opened the second half with a 21-8 spurt to lead 61-43 with 12:17 left.
